Multiple basal cell carcinomas in Gorlin Syndrome treated with pulsed dye laser.
Summary: This study evaluated the effectiveness of pulsed dye laser (PDL) as a treatment of basal cell carcinomas (BCC) in a patient with Gorlin Syndrome.
Conclusion: A patient with basal cell carcinomas with Gorlin Syndrome, was successfully treated with a pulsed dye laser.
This is an observational study demonstrating the effectiveness of pulsed dye laser (PDL) as a treatment of basal cell carcinomas (BCC) in patients with Gorlin Syndrome. Over 200 BCCs localized to the head, neck, trunk, and extremities of a patient suffering from Gorlin Syndrome were successfully treated with PDL without subsequent scarring. PDL is a simple and rapid modality to destroy BCCs arising in patients with Gorlin Syndrome resulting in a preferable cosmetic outcome.
